What is Inflammation Control Red Therapy?

Inflammation control red therapy involves the use of red and near-infrared light to stimulate cellular processes that promote healing. This therapy works by penetrating the skin and reaching the underlying tissues, where it can enhance mitochondrial function. Mitochondria are the powerhouse of cells, and their optimal functioning is essential for energy production and cellular repair.

How Does It Work?

The mechanism behind inflammation control red therapy is fascinating. When red light is absorbed by the cells, it triggers a series of biochemical reactions. These reactions lead to increased ATP (adenosine triphosphate) production, which is vital for energy transfer within cells. Additionally, red light therapy can:

  • Reduce oxidative stress
  • Enhance circulation
  • Promote collagen production
  • Regulate inflammatory responses

These benefits make inflammation control red therapy a powerful tool in managing chronic inflammation and improving overall health.

Benefits of Red Light Therapy for Inflammation

Many studies have highlighted the potential benefits of inflammation control red therapy. Some of the most notable advantages include:

  1. Pain Relief: Red light therapy can alleviate pain associated with inflammation, making it easier for individuals to engage in daily activities.
  2. Improved Recovery: Athletes often use red light therapy to speed up recovery from injuries and reduce muscle soreness.
  3. Enhanced Skin Health: This therapy can improve skin conditions like acne and psoriasis by reducing inflammation and promoting healing.
  4. Support for Joint Health: Individuals with arthritis may find relief from joint pain and stiffness through regular use of red light therapy.
